Understanding Chinese Composition Basics

One of the fundamental aspects of mastering Chinese composition is grasping the basic structure and components of written Chinese. Understanding the fundamental elements such as characters, radicals, strokes https://www.yanzimandarin.com/, and Pinyin is crucial for effective communication in written Chinese.

Characters are the building blocks of Chinese writing, each carrying its own meaning and pronunciation. Radicals, which are components of characters, provide clues to the characters’ meanings or pronunciation. Strokes are the individual movements used to write characters, and mastering stroke order is essential for writing legible Chinese. Pinyin, the Romanization of Chinese characters based on their pronunciation, aids in pronunciation and language learning.

Developing a Strong Vocabulary

Having a strong vocabulary is paramount in mastering Chinese composition, as it serves as the foundation for effective communication and expression in written Chinese. To enhance your vocabulary, read extensively in Chinese to encounter new words in context. Practice writing regularly to reinforce the words you learn.

Create vocabulary lists based on themes or topics to organize your learning. Utilize flashcards or digital apps to review and test yourself regularly. Engage in conversations with native speakers to practice using new words in context.

Explore Chinese media such as movies, TV shows, or podcasts to expose yourself to a variety of vocabulary. By actively seeking out new words and incorporating them into your writing, you can steadily expand and strengthen your Chinese vocabulary.

Structuring Your Composition Effectively

To effectively convey your ideas in Chinese composition, structuring your writing with clarity and coherence is essential. Start by outlining your main points, ensuring a logical flow from introduction to conclusion.

Begin with a captivating introduction to hook your readers, followed by well-organized body paragraphs that expand on your ideas. Use transition words to connect sentences and paragraphs smoothly. Ensure each paragraph focuses on a single idea and supports it with relevant details.

Conclude by summarizing your main points and leaving a lasting impression on the reader. Remember, a well-structured composition not only enhances readability but also showcases your mastery of the Chinese language.

Practice structuring your compositions to elevate your writing skills.

Incorporating Literary Devices

Effective incorporation of literary devices in Chinese composition elevates the overall quality and impact of the writing, enhancing the reader’s engagement and understanding. By skillfully weaving in literary devices such as metaphors, similes, and personification, students can add depth and layers to their compositions.

Metaphors allow for complex ideas to be conveyed in a more relatable manner, similes create vivid comparisons that paint a clear picture in the reader’s mind, and personification breathes life into inanimate objects or abstract concepts. Additionally, employing techniques like foreshadowing or symbolism can add intrigue and thematic richness to the narrative.

When used thoughtfully and purposefully, these literary devices can transform a simple piece of writing into a compelling and memorable composition.
